The DS1020 programmable 8-bit silicon delay line consists of an 8-bit user programmable CMOS silicon integrated circuit. The delay value, programmed using a 3-wire serial port or an 8-bit parallel port, can vary in 256 equal steps. All models have an inherent (step size zero) delay of 10ns. It offers a standard 16-pin automatic insert DIP and a space-saving surface mount 16-pin SOIC.

The LTC6811 is a multi-cell stack monitor that measures up to 12 cells connected in series with a total measurement error of less than 1.2mV. The 0V to 5V battery measurement range makes the LTC6811 suitable for most battery chemicals.
The LT4356 surge plug protects loads from high voltage transients. It regulates the output during an overvoltage event, such as a load dump in a car, by controlling the gate of an external n-channel MOSFET. The output is limited to a safe value, allowing the load to continue working.

The LM5033 high-voltage PWM controller contains all the functionality needed to implement push-pull, half-bridge, and full-bridge topologies. Applications include closed-loop voltage-mode converters with highly regulated output voltage, or open-loop DC transformers such as intermediate bus converters (IBCs) with efficiencies greater than 95%.
BQ77908A is a battery protection and battery balancing device for lithium ion and lithium polymer battery packs. The BQ77908A monitors series 4 to 8 individual cell voltages and provides a fast-acting output that can be used to drive an N-channel mosfet interrupt power path.
The TLV5604 is a four-way 10-bit voltage output digital-to-analog converter (DAC) with a flexible 4-wire serial interface. 4-wire serial interface allows glueless interface to TMS320, SPI, QSPI and Microwire serial ports. The TLV5604 is programmed with a 16-bit serial word consisting of a DAC address, separate DAC control bits, and a 10-bit DAC value.
